              Vue is a landscape modeller mostly and can handle large scenes with many objects and details..
              I would suggest getting a demo or the PLE it is well worth trying out.

              It is made by e-on software and is available here as well as thier many other exciting products.

                yeah what the Devil said... it's got a free demo version that leaves a watermark. it's pretty simple but it pretty much requires that you buy this little SketchUp to Vue exporter it's like $25... but the landscaping that you put around your models is incredible... very life like. it has several different levels of software, all the same base really and then with different add-ons to make it more and more complete taking you from rendering single shots to making movies.

                you gotta see it to believe it.
